#5f6087 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5f6087 is composed of 37.3% red, 37.6%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.6% cyan, 28.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 238.5 degrees, a saturation of 17.4% and a lightness of 45.1%. #5f6087 color hex could be obtained by blending #bec0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#5f6087 color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.

#5f6087 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5f6087 has RGB values of R:95, G:96, B:135 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 6250631.

Shades and Tints of #5f6087

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060608 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5f6087

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717175 is the less saturated color, while #070cdf is the most saturated one.
